UASt regulatory sequences drive expression of an inverted repeat.
Expression of Rh50GD3847 under the control of Scer\GAL4da.G32 (in combination with a Dicer-2 transgene to enhance RNAi efficiency) leads to lethality that occurred at different stages of development according to the temperature at which the flies are reared. Animals raised at 29[o] die before third instar larvae while the ones raised at 25[o] survive until pupal stage.
Expression of Rh50GD3847 under the control of Scer\GAL4da.G32 (in combination with a Dicer-2) leads to longer and thinner pupae.
Expression of Rh50GD3847 under the control of Scer\GAL4how-24B (in combination with a Dicer-2) leads to narrower and more elongated body wall muscles, which display an irregular shape that resemble a dystrophy, in third instar larvae.
Expression of Rh50GD3847 under the control of Scer\GAL4how-24B,Scer\GAL4C57 or Scer\GAL4Mhc.PK (in combination with a Dicer-2) leads to impaired crawling of third instar larvae.
Expression of Rh50GD3847 under the control of Scer\GAL4how-24B (in combination with a Dicer-2) leads to an increase in the mean frequency of miniature EPSPs (mEPSPs) in Muscles 6 and 7 of third instar larvae.
Adults expressing Rh50GD3847 under the control of Scer\GAL4elav.PLu (in the presence of Dcr-2Scer\UAS.cDa to increase the efficiency of RNAi) do not show a significant defect in avoidance of noxious temperature (46[o]C) compared to control flies.
